**Runbook: LotPulse occupancy feed stalls**

The LotPulse feed publishes garage occupancy counts every 30 seconds from the Bramley Deck sensors. If the dashboard shows a flat line, first check the aggregator pod in the north cluster — it usually just needs a restart. Counts self-heal within two cycles. Before restarting, capture the current trace token from the aggregator logs and paste it here.

pipeline stamp: htk9_6ce9d33c5

The nightly fleet fuel-usage report for Haulwright Dispatch failed again on the aggregation stage. The cause is a stale partition map cached by the Kernwick scheduler after yesterday's depot rename; the job reads the old partition and times out. Workaround: clear the scheduler cache and rerun the report with the fresh manifest before 06:00 so ops gets their numbers. If it fails a third time, escalate to the data platform rotation. The failing run can be identified by the trace token below.

build token for bahip-fawif: htk3_6a1

Action item from the Lanternmap outage review: the tile prefetcher in Cartovane aggressively warmed zoom levels 14–16 during the regional rollout, saturating the origin store and delaying live tile serves by up to nine seconds. We agreed to gate prefetch concurrency behind a release flag and cap it at 20% of origin capacity until the adaptive throttle ships. Please confirm the flag defaults before cutting the next release candidate. The rollout checklist and flag reference live on the page below.

operations page: https://jira.qorvelsys.internal/browse/pages/browse/pages

## Sprigloop Plugin Release — Signing Step

Applies to all third-party plugins for the Sprigloop watering scheduler. Before submitting: bump version, run the schema check, tag the build. All plugin bundles must be signed or the scheduler refuses to load them at runtime — no exceptions, even for beta channels. Use the platform verification key to confirm your toolchain is signing correctly. The current Sprigloop platform key is as follows.

deploy key for kajof-fajop: bky6_gDHw9Q